#ifndef __SUNXI_POWER_H__
#define __SUNXI_POWER_H__
#include <bl_common.h>
#include <platform_def.h>
int sunxi_pmic_setup(void);
/* Register-level access */
int sunxi_pmic_read(uint8_t address, uint8_t *value);
int sunxi_pmic_write(uint8_t address, uint8_t value);
int sunxi_pmic_set_bit(uint8_t address, uint8_t bit);
int sunxi_pmic_clear_bit(uint8_t address, uint8_t bit);
/* Regulator-level access */
enum axp803_regulator {
AXP803_DLDO1,
AXP803_DLDO2,
AXP803_DLDO3,
AXP803_DLDO4,
AXP803_ELDO1,
AXP803_ELDO2,
AXP803_ELDO3,
AXP803_FLDO1,
AXP803_FLDO2,
AXP803_DCDC1,
AXP803_DCDC2,
AXP803_DCDC3,
AXP803_DCDC4,
AXP803_DCDC5,
AXP803_DCDC6,
AXP803_ALDO1,
AXP803_ALDO2,
AXP803_ALDO3,
};
int sunxi_pmic_set_voltage(enum axp803_regulator r, uint32_t mvolt);
int sunxi_pmic_get_voltage(enum axp803_regulator r, uint32_t *mvolt);
int sunxi_pmic_set_enable(enum axp803_regulator r, uint32_t enable);
int sunxi_pmic_get_enable(enum axp803_regulator r, uint32_t *enable);
/* Task-level access */
enum pmic_task_type {
PMIC_SET_VOLTAGE,
PMIC_SET_ENABLE,
};
struct pmic_task {
enum pmic_task_type t;
enum axp803_regulator r;
uint32_t val; /* mvolt or enable */
};
int sunxi_pmic_run_tasks(struct pmic_task *tasks, size_t tasks_num);
#endif /* __SUNXI_POWER_H__ */
